dapD2,3,4,5-tetrahydropyridine-2-carboxylate N-succinyltransferase; Function of homologous gene experimentally demonstrated in an other organism; enzyme; Belongs to the transferase hexapeptide repeat family. (280 aa)    
Predicted Functional Partners:
dapB
Dihydrodipicolinate reductase; Catalyzes the conversion of 4-hydroxy-tetrahydrodipicolinate (HTPA) to tetrahydrodipicolinate; Belongs to the DapB family.

dapE
N-succinyl-diaminopimelate deacylase (dapE); Catalyzes the hydrolysis of N-succinyl-L,L-diaminopimelic acid (SDAP), forming succinate and LL-2,6-diaminoheptanedioate (DAP), an intermediate involved in the bacterial biosynthesis of lysine and meso-diaminopimelic acid, an essential component of bacterial cell walls; Belongs to the peptidase M20A family. DapE subfamily.
